Bentley Motors Expands European Presence With Opening Of Bentley Tbilisi In Georgia
Bentley Motors has announced its expansion into the Georgian market with Bentley Tbilisi, which is set to open in spring 2025. The showroom, located at Aghmashenebeli Alley 129 in Tbilisi, is already welcoming visitors. This move comes as Bentley aims to strengthen its presence in Europe.
The new Bentley Tbilisi will feature a 330-square-metre showroom and a shared 730-square-metre workshop. These facilities will include an aftersales service area to cater to customer needs. Tegeta, an independent group, will manage the operations as the exclusive retailer for Bentley in Georgia.
In the first half of 2024, Bentley Motors achieved an operating profit of €261 million. The company delivered 5,476 cars worldwide, with 1,054 units sold in Europe, accounting for 19% of their global sales. This success underlines Bentley's strategic growth plans in the region.
The launch of Bentley Tbilisi coincides with the introduction of two Ultra Performance Hybrid models: the fourth-generation Continental GT and the Flying Spur Speed. These models are expected to meet increasing demand for personalised luxury vehicles through Mulliner customisation options.
Richard Leopold, Regional Director for Europe, UK, and MEAI at Bentley Motors, expressed enthusiasm about this development. He stated: "This appointment marks a new milestone for Bentley Motors in Georgia, a market we see with opportunity."
